Replacement/issue of a new residence registration certificate

When to apply?

Make application for replacement/issue of a new certificate about registering the residence of a UK citizen when the validity of the document you have expires.

The application should be submitted at least 30 days before the expiry of the current document.

Make exchange request a certificate of registration of the residence of a citizen of the United Kingdom, if the document you have had so far has been damaged, you have lost it or the data contained in it has changed.

The application must be submitted within 14 days after the above-mentioned conditions for their replacement have occurred.

You submit the application in person. The requirement to submit an application in person does not apply a minor, who was under 6 years of age on the date of submission of the application.

Where to submit the application?

Correctly and completely filled out proposal deposit in Polish personally at the Department for Foreigners in Warsaw at ul. Marszałkowska 3/5, mezzanine, stand 21 (take a number with the letter "I").

If you are unable to submit your application in person, please send a complete and correctly completed paper application by post. You can also submit it through the registry office, ul. Marszałkowska 3/5 Warsaw, pl. Bankowy 3/5 Warsaw.

If you submit your application by post or through the application office, you will have to wait for the Office's summons. Then, after receiving the summons, you will be required to appear in person on the date indicated in the summons in order to present the original documents. During the visit, you can also submit other required documents.

What documents to submit?

Documents needed to replace / issue a new certificate of registration of EU citizen's stay:

  • proposal in one copy, completed in Polish, in accordance with the instruction;
  • 2 Photos;
  • photocopy a valid travel document (original available for inspection);
  • fingerprinting (in case of minors Fingerprints are taken from children who are 6 years of age or older on the day the application is submitted).

Check which documents confirm the fulfillment of the conditions for the right to stay on the territory of the Republic of Poland.

All documents are submitted in original/certified copy. You can complete the missing documents in person at our Department, ul. Marszałkowska 3/5 Warsaw, stand 21, ticket with the letter "I" or through the registry office of the office, ul. Marszałkowska 3/5 Warsaw, pl. Bankowy 3/5 Warsaw.

How to pick up the document?

You can collect the certificate of registration of the stay of a ZK citizen in person at the seat of our Department, stand 21, ul. Marszałkowska 3/5 Warszawa, you need to take a ticket with the letter "V".

Customer reception hours: Monday 10:00-17:30, Tuesday - Friday 8:00-15:00.

What should I know?

The party may appeal against the negative decision to the Head of the Office for Foreigners - through the Mazowieckie Voivode - within 14 days from the date of its delivery.

Before the deadline for filing an appeal expires, the party may waive the right to appeal against the public administration body that issued the decision.

On the day of delivery to the public administration body of the statement on the waiver of the right to appeal by the last party to the proceedings, the decision becomes final and binding.

If the right to appeal against the decision is waived, there is no right to appeal to the administrative court.

What are my obligations after issuing the document?

You should report to the voivode competent for the place of your residence in the case of:

  • changes to the data contained in the document,
  • document loss,
  • damage or other circumstances that make it difficult to determine the identity of the holder,
  • expiry date of the document.
